Dagmar Pelger is an architect and urban planner. She teaches and conducts research on mapping methods as collaborative design tools and on models of communal urban space production, ranging from landscape to neighborhood. Since 2017, she has been part of the planning cooperative coopdisco Berlin.
Sibylle Peters is a researcher, artist, and theater director living in Hamburg. She conceives and leads participatory art-based research projects. She holds a Ph.D. in literary and media theory and is currently working on her habilitation thesis, a study on the lecture as performance. Sibylle Peters is co-founder and artistic director of the Fundus Theater / Theatre of Research in Hamburg (since 2001). Her current work and publications include transgenerational live art, performing citizenship, hydrarchy & radical seafaring, the art of being many, interspecies zones of equality, heterosexuality, creative destruction, improbability drives, and paralogistics.
